Breast microcalcifications after lumpectomy and radiation therapy

Summary
Microcalcifications after breast cancer surgery and radiation can be suspicious. Excisional biopsy is recommended for suspect microcalcifications to differentiate benign from malignant recurrence.

Background:
- Breast cancer treatment often involves surgery and radiation therapy.
- Post-treatment breast changes, including calcifications, can occur.
- Differentiating benign post-treatment changes from recurrent malignancy is crucial.
Purpose of the Study:
- To evaluate the nature of microcalcifications developing after breast cancer surgery and radiation.
- To determine the specificity of mammographic features in distinguishing benign from malignant calcifications.
- To assess the diagnostic yield of reexcision for suspect microcalcifications.
Main Methods:
- Retrospective analysis of 152 breast cancer patients treated with excisional biopsy and radiation.
- Mammographic follow-up to monitor calcification development and stability.
- Reexcision and histopathological analysis of suspect microcalcifications.
Main Results:
- Seven percent (10/152) of patients developed suspect microcalcifications post-treatment.
- Reexcision revealed malignancy in 40% (4/10) of these patients.
- Mammographic appearance was insufficient to reliably distinguish benign from malignant calcifications.
- Malignant calcifications tended to appear earlier than benign ones.
Conclusions:
- Suspect microcalcifications after breast cancer surgery and radiation require careful evaluation.
- Excisional biopsy is recommended for microcalcifications unless they have a clearly benign appearance.
- Mammographic features alone cannot exclude recurrent malignancy in post-treatment calcifications.
